Chicken wings slow cooked with a spicy tangy sauce mixture which includes chili sauce, chili powder lemon juice and molasses!
Ingredients
- 5.5 pounds chicken wings , split and tips discarded
- 1 can or bottle chile sauce , 12 fluid ounce
- 0.25 cups fresh lemon juice
- 0.25 cups molasses
- 2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
- 3 dropss hot pepper sauce
- 1 tablespoon salsa
- 2.5 teaspoons chili powder
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 2 teaspoons salt
Instructions
-
1
Place chicken in slow cooker. In a medium bowl combine the chile sauce, lemon juice, molasses, Worcestershire sauce, hot pepper sauce, salsa, chili powder, garlic powder and salt. Mix together and pour mixture over chicken.
-
2
Cook in slow cooker on Medium Low setting for 5 hours.
